Elizabeth Pando is a scholar working on Surgery, Oncology and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Elizabeth Pando has authored 27 papers receiving a total of 248 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Surgery, 14 papers in Oncology and 8 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. Recurrent topics in Elizabeth Pando’s work include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(14 papers), Pancreatitis Pathology and Treatment (11 papers) and Organ Transplantation Techniques and Outcomes (6 papers). Elizabeth Pando is often cited by papers focused on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(14 papers), Pancreatitis Pathology and Treatment (11 papers) and Organ Transplantation Techniques and Outcomes (6 papers). Elizabeth Pando collaborates with scholars based in Spain, Peru and United States. Elizabeth Pando's co-authors include R. Charco, Cristina Dopazo, M. Caralt, Antonio M. Lacy, Cedric Adelsdorfer, Alberto Delitala, Ricard Corcelles, Salvadora Delgado, Josép Vidal and Concepción Gómez‐Gavara and has published in prestigious journals such as Annals of Surgery, Cancer Treatment Reviews and World Journal of Surgery.
